About
This super clean and sunny 1.5 BR apt features brand new HWF's, 2 fireplace mantels, a very large BR with huge Windows, beautiful french doors separate the BR from the Large LR, Generous sized dining room with enough room for a table of 6+. Nice kitchen w/ new appliances and nice tiled bath There's another separate room off the BR for a large office or studio. Good Closets.

Park Slope has a tranquil, easygoing vibe and can almost feel suburban. Strollers and children of all ages are a constant presence on sidewalks, as are shoppers patronizing local boutiques and dog walkers heading up to the park. Residents are Brooklynites through and through and tend to be socially conscious, artistically minded, and committed to their community. At night, a casual restaurant scene comes alive. For anyone looking for a night out, there are plenty of beer gardens and wine bars to patronize, especially in the South Slope, but don't go looking for dance clubs.
